A group of scientists from the UK plans to create an analogue of the Matrix
Recently, the British company Improbable, which specializiruetsya on the development of software for the simulation of virtual worlds has received from a Japanese Corporation SoftBank grant in the amount of 502 million dollars. This event would have remained unnoticed if not for one thing: the money allocated for the creation of “the most accurate three-dimensional model of the real world”. Simply put, the creation of a counterpart of the matrix from the famous movie brothers, and now sisters, Wachowski.
